Located within the traditional market town of Forfar. Daily shopping needs are well met in the town with retailers including a post office, bakery, supermarkets, and convenience stores and there is a dentist, library, and health centre. There is a popular monthly farmers market and several restaurants, cafes, and bars. For an even greater choice of cultural and visitor attractions, vibrant Dundee, home to the V&A and the revitalized waterfront with the famous RRS Discovery is a thirty-minute drive and Aberdeen is only an hour away. The town boasts a golf club, football club, ice rink, and a sports centre with a swimming pool, gym, all-weather pitches, tennis courts, and fitness classes. Edinburgh is approximately just under two hours to the south. The area is surrounded by stunning countryside with wonderful opportunities to explore the Angus Glens and the great outdoors at scenic destinations including Balmashanner Hill, Forfar Loch Country Park, and Crombie Country Park. Various visitor attractions include Glamis Castle, Murton Farm, and Neverland Play Park. Alongside local primary and high schooling in Forfar, there are private options available at The High School of Dundee. There is a good bus service locally, and a train station in Dundee, with Edinburgh International Airport 90 minutes away by car. Domestic flights are available from Dundee Airport.

*Guide Price: An indication of a seller's minimum expectation at auction and given as a Guide Price or a range of Guide Prices. This is not necessarily the figure a property will sell for and is subject to change prior to the auction.
Reserve Price: Each auction property will be subject to a Reserve Price below which the property cannot be sold at auction. Normally the Reserve Price will be set within the range of Guide Prices or no more than 10% above a single Guide Price.
